Total count of valid coupons. 25.If you cancel a trip, you may seriously disrupt guests’ plans and impact their confidence in Turo hosts; if possible, try to find an alternative arrang...Trip fees go directly to Turo and help us run the Turo platform. The trip fee is calculated at checkout and varies dynamically. You always have a chance to review your trip fee before completing your reservation. For example, in the US, trip fees range from 2.5% to 100% of the trip price and Extras, with a $15 minimum on each trip.What does the rental car collision damage waiver not cover? If you're renting a car in the United States, your regular ...When a trip fee on Turo is quite high, it is due to certain factors. Firstly, the higher the value of the rental car, the higher the trip fee will be. Shorter bookings on Turo also result in higher trip fees for users. Finally, last-minute bookings have higher trip fees than those made in advance. Turo’s trip fees can vary depending on the type of vehicle you rent, the length of your rental period, and other factors.Aug 19, 2022 · Hosts will be subject to a $50* fee if they cancel a trip less than 24 hours before the start of the trip. If they cancel more than 24 hours before the start of the trip, the fee is $25*. After each canceled trip, hosts receive an automated review on their vehicle listing. It mentions the cancellation and how far in advance they canceled the trip.

You must be 18 or older to book a trip with a peer-to-peer host. If you're age 18-21, you can't decline a protection plan or choose Premier protection. You must choose either the Minimum protection plan or the Standard protection plan. If you're age 18-20, you'll pay a minimum Young driver fee of $50/day.Trip Fee: This is a small charge — a percentage of the trip price — calculated at checkout.
